WebbAccording to the standards, the height for the countertop is – 850 to 900 mm and the standard depth of the countertop is – 600 mm. For an island countertop (an option that must be considered in the case of large kitchens), the ideal dimensions are 1200 x 900 mm, to accommodate ease of working. Webb17 aug. 2024 · Standard kitchen counter depth is 24 inches, but there are variations. Counter depth is the depth of the countertop, from the front to the back. The standard depth is 24 inches, but there are variations. Some countertops are deeper, at 26 or even 28 inches, while others are shallower, at just 21 or 22 inches.
Webb21 aug. 2024 · Standard wall cabinet depth is 12 inches for manufacturers working in inches and 30cm for manufacturers working in metric measurements. Standard wall cabinet widths mirror the widths available for base cabinets ie 12, 15, 18, 24, 30, 36 inches and 30, 40, 50, 60, 80cm.
